Use a default zip software installed on your Uni.lu laptop to zip your file(s) with a strong password. +* Use a password generator (e.g. dice ware, PrivateBin) to make the password strong. +* The password is needed to decrypt the data, thus ensure the password is stored securely. +2. Go to [LCSB PrivateBin](https://privatebin.lcsb.uni.lu/) and type/add the password in the Editor tab. +* Enable the feature "Burn after reading" by ticking the checkbox. This means that the link to the password can only be used **once** so it expires upon first access. +<img src="img/encryptionpassword.png"> +* You will be asked to enter your LUMS credentials once you click on "Send". +* You should be redirected to a page containing the password link. +<img src="img/passwordLink.png"> +3. Share the password link with your collaborator via your preferred communication channel. +4. The collaborator must confirm that the password was received before proceeding to share the encrypted file(s). +5. Login to [OwnCloud](https://owncloud.lcsb.uni.lu/) with LUMS account. LUMS account can be requested via the [Service Portal](https://service.uni.lu/sp?id=sc_cat_item&table=sc_cat_item&sys_id=c536257ddb336010ca53454039961936). +* Upload the zipped file(s) to OwnCloud and make a share link with the collaborator. +* See a full guide on how to use [OwnCloud](https://howto.lcsb.uni.lu/?exchange-channels:owncloud). +<img src="img/owncloudShare.png"> +6. Share the access link with your collaborator by typing in their email as shown on the image above. +* The collaborator will automatically receive a link to the encrypted data on OwnCloud by email. +7. The collaborator can now decrypt the data with the password received via Privatebin.
